Output 80ba0a3ba95722076ff7cde7fe5e2c1a34016f0385ecf6604065953e2c5df81f:0

value
2558672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565211964b2d31c9577769bd47c20dfaf355b7bb OP_EQUAL
address
39ZSMGsGmaqL8yJozGMWy8xxKuxVwnE5ip
transaction
80ba0a3ba95722076ff7cde7fe5e2c1a34016f0385ecf6604065953e2c5df81f
spent
true